According to the results of a survey, 37% of 252 people indicated that American football is their favorite sport. Assuming that the percentage remains the same, how many more people should be surveyed to have a margin of error of 2%? Round up to the nearest whole number, if necessary. In order to have a margin of error of 2%, you need to survey D more people. Suppose that the results of a survey show that 47% of people consider summer as their favorite season. How many people should be surveyed in order to have a margin of error of 4%? Round up to the nearest whole number, if necessary. In order to have a margin of error of 4%, D people should be surveyed
